How fitness matters in Covid-19?

Well, the title makes it clear that today’s blog is about fitness. It was until this pandemic came and engulfed us that we realised that fitness is extremely critical. Fitness is personal and can have different definitions for different people. For me, it is a mind-set. But for you, it can be weight loss or working on your stamina or strength training or fixing anything which concerns your health.

Things are not going to get normal anytime soon though we hope for the best. However, one thing is sure that being fit is a necessity more than a luxury. Gone are those days when going to a gym was a status symbol for the majority of us. It's a much needed regime right now and we all need to take care of our fitness levels. Years of sedentary lifestyle, money mind-set and a constant urge to work, work and just work made me overlook the fact that my health was getting compromised. However, I didn’t bother much and followed my unhealthy habits to make things worse for me. So, here I examine some ways that can make all of us overlook our health.


  • Too lazy to change to a healthy regime

  • Too occupied to do any physical activity such as gym, yoga, walking etc

  • Lack of any mind-set to be fit

  • Lack of awareness & knowledge 

  • Too much stress in life, work or college 

  • Lack of resources 


There can be many reasons as to why you have overlooked your health all these years. However, there have been different studies conducted in the past & present indicating that health remains a top priority for anyone and everyone after this Covid-19 has brought the world to a standstill. It is understandable that your method of taking care of yourself can be different. 


Let’s discuss some health benefits that I have got all these months taking care of my health. This list is not exhaustive but includes some instant benefits that any of my readers can relate to.


  • A positive change in life

  • Weight-loss or weight-gain as per preferences (weight loss in my case)

  • A healthy vibe and perspective 

  • Highly productive in personal & professional commitments 

  • Stress buster
  • Better immunity to fight viruses like Covid-19
  • Getting rid of the negative elements



It’s high time that we start taking our health too seriously. The times of Covid-19 has definitely taught us that eventually it's always about the good food, healthy regime and good perspective for leading a fulfilling life though material things keep following. So fitness is not just about weight loss. It's beyond that and can be extremely personal. There is no thumb rule as to how fitness should be maintained. It depends on the preferences and varies from person to person.
